The Intra-Africa Trade Fair (IATF) is more than an event; it is an initiative that resonates deeply with supporting the implementation of the African Continental Free Trade Area (AfCFTA). Organized by Afreximbank in collaboration with the African Union and AfCFTA Secretariat, and as the theme for 2023 is “Building Bridges for a successful AfCFTA”, the IATF stands as a step towards bridging the gap in trade and market information for a more integrated and prosperous Africa.
